Distichous Leafed Dendrobium

Dendrobium distichum

Description:

epiphytic orchid, small flower, less than 1cm

Habitat:

tropical rainforest

Notes:

I found this orchid lying on the ground in Tangkoko Batuangus National Park. The branch it was growing on had broken off from a tree. This is one great way to see epiphytic orchids. I always check fallen branches and have spotted more than one orchid this way. It is D. section aporum, pretty sure about the species.
